About Lancaster
Summers have an average temperature of 19 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%. Winters bring an average temperature of 4 °C, with humidity levels of about 85%.
Lancaster is home of the academic institute Lancaster University. The biggest sports facility in Lancaster is Giant Axe,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Royal Lancaster Infirmary.
Nature lovers can unwind at Williamson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Lancaster City Museum, which showcases Lancaster’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Lancaster Library for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Leeds Bradford Airport by Bus and Taxi.
There are several ways to get around Lancaster with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us and Train.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Lancaster Bus Station and Lancaster Railway Station.
In Lancaster,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Cash, Card and Mobile payment.
About Cirencester
Summers have an average temperature of 19 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%. Winters bring an average temperature of 4 °C, with humidity levels of about 85%.
Cirencester is home of the academic institute Royal Agricultural University. The biggest sports facility in Cirencester is Cirencester Rugby Club Ground,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Cirencester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at Cirencester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Corinium Museum, which showcases Cirencester’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Bingham Library for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Bristol Airport by Bus and Taxi.
There are several ways to get around Cirencester with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us and Train.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Cirencester Bus Station and Kemble Railway Station.
In Cirencester,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Cash and Card.
